Understanding the Mechanics of the Aviator Game
At its heart, the aviator game is a game of chance, governed by a provably fair random number generator (RNG). This means the outcome of each round is determined by an algorithm that is transparent and verifiable, ensuring fairness and eliminating the possibility of manipulation. Players begin by placing a bet, and with each new round, an airplane takes off. A multiplier begins to increase as the plane climbs higher, representing the potential return on the player’s bet. The key to success lies in knowing when to cash out.
The game ends when the plane flies away, and any bets that have not been cashed out are lost. This creates a thrilling dynamic where players must constantly assess their risk tolerance and make split-second decisions. The multiplier at which a player chooses to cash out directly determines their winnings. For example, if a player bets $10 and cashes out at a multiplier of 2.0, they will receive a payout of $20 (their initial bet plus $10 profit). Understanding the inherent risk-reward relationship is fundamental to playing the aviator game effectively. Strategic players don’t just randomly cash out; they develop strategies based on observing patterns, setting profit targets, and managing their bankroll.

The Psychology of Playing Aviator
The aviator game isn't just about mathematical probabilities; it also taps into fundamental aspects of human psychology. The escalating multiplier creates a sense of anticipation and excitement, while the risk of losing the bet adds a layer of tension. This combination can be highly addictive, leading some players to chase their losses or take unnecessary risks. Understanding these psychological factors is crucial for responsible gameplay.
The “near miss” effect, where a player almost achieves a large payout but the plane flies away just before they cash out, can be particularly frustrating and can encourage players to continue betting in an attempt to recoup their losses. This is a common cognitive bias that can lead to irrational decision-making. Similarly, the feeling of being “on a winning streak” can create a false sense of confidence, prompting players to increase their bets and take on more risk. It’s important to maintain a level head and stick to a pre-defined strategy, regardless of whether you’re winning or losing.
Responsible Gambling Practices
Given the addictive potential of the aviator game, it’s essential to practice responsible gambling. This includes setting a budget and sticking to it, avoiding chasing losses, and taking regular breaks. It's also important to recognize the signs of problem gambling, such as spending more money than you can afford to lose, neglecting personal responsibilities, or experiencing anxiety or depression as a result of gambling. If you or someone you know is struggling with problem gambling, there are resources available to help. Many online casinos offer self-exclusion options, which allow players to temporarily or permanently block themselves from accessing the site.
Remember that the aviator game is intended to be a form of entertainment, and it should be treated as such. It’s not a guaranteed source of income, and it’s important to approach it with a realistic mindset. Never bet more than you can afford to lose, and always prioritize your financial well-being. By practicing responsible gambling, you can enjoy the thrill of the aviator game without putting yourself at risk.

Emerging Trends in Provably Fair Gaming
The core appeal of the aviator game, beyond its exciting gameplay, rests firmly on its provably fair system. This burgeoning approach to online gambling transparency is experiencing a significant surge in interest and development. Beyond simply verifying randomness, developers are increasingly exploring ways to give players even greater control and oversight of the game's underlying logic. This includes allowing players to contribute to the seed generation process, further solidifying trust and accountability.
One intriguing development is the integration of decentralized autonomous organizations (DAOs) into the gaming ecosystem. DAOs could potentially allow players to collectively govern the rules and parameters of the game, creating a truly community-driven experience. This shift towards decentralization represents a fundamental change in the relationship between players and game operators, empowering users and fostering a more equitable and transparent gaming environment.
